[6] In Satara district, it passes through Mol, Lalgun, Pusegaon, Khatav, Vaduj and Nimsod.
After flowing in the south-east direction, the major attraction on this river is the Nagnath Temple of Lord Shiva at Nagnathwadi near Lalgun.
Later the river enters in Ner dam which is an attractive place for seasonal migratory birds.
[8] In Pusegaon there is a famous temple of Shri Sevagiri Maharaj on the bank of Yerala river.
Greater flamingoes, winter migratory ducks, waders have a great diversity in this region.
